About Me

i am a 26 year graduate in human resource management 2012 from iten kenya, i stayed at home jobless for a year before venturing into farming 2013,i started with potato farming for a year before venturing into chicken farming to realise higher income,to date the business has been very good though lack of capital has hindered expansion to target the big market available .
by zidisha chipping in it will help expand my capacity and stock thus help in achieving more in terms of medicine food and stock for the chicken farming venture.thanks

My Business

car wash venture is my other source of income where i do car washing for income i make an average of 400sh net income per day this has helped a lot introducing me into chicken farming which helps me realise a higher profit margin from the few eggs sold,i started car wash business after selling my farm produce late 2013 to date its doing well.

Loan Proposal

i would like build a better poultry house then acquire a higher number of stock(kienyeji chicken) alongside chicken feed to boost their production plus medicine to help prevent recurrent diseases.
i've made a good research and found there is higher market for kienyeji chicken products thus a better profit margin.thanks
